#f798e1 Color Information

In a RGB color space, hex #f798e1 is composed of 96.9% red, 59.6% green and 88.2%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 0% cyan, 38.5% magenta, 8.9% yellow and 3.1% black. It has a hue angle of 313.9 degrees, a saturation of 85.6% and a lightness of 78.2%. #f798e1 color hex could be obtained by blending #ffffff with #ef31c3. Closest websafe color is: #ff99cc.

Shades and Tints of #f798e1

A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#060005 is the darkest color, while #fef3fc is the lightest one.
